    • A sliding assisting apparatus assists a movable body to move between a drawn-out position and a drawn-in position. The apparatus includes a unit main body to be attached to a main body or the movable body, and a pair of strikers to be attached to the main body or movable body. The unit main body includes a pair of sliders slidably disposed inside a case, lock members movably supported on the respective sliders, coupling parts provided on the case for engaging the lock members, and an urging device provided between the sliders for accumulating a force when the sliders slide away from the other. One striker switches one slider between a case restrained position in which one coupling part engages one lock member and a case restraint released position in which the one coupling part releases the one lock member.

    • A molding for mounting in a gap between an outer periphery and a window frame of an automobile is disclosed. The molding is formed of a length of material having first and second pillar sections extending into corner sections, the corner sections being interconnected via a roof section. A cross-section of the molding includes a leg portion and a head portion extending therefrom, the head portion having a parasol-shape and overhanging the leg portion. A glass lip projects from a first side of the leg portion, the molding being configured to receive an outer periphery of the front glass between the glass lip and a lower surface of the head portion. Additionally, a panel lip projects from a second side of the leg portion, the panel lip being adapted to elastically abut and engage the window frame of the automobile. Further, a groove lip extends over a length of each of the pillar portions, and projects from the upper surface of the head portion. The groove lip is formed of a material different from the other components of the molding, but is integrally extruded with the other components.

    • A latching device for a vehicle comprises a hollow casing having open front and rear ends, a latching member supported for sliding motion within the casing so as to protrude through the open front end of the casing, biasing means for biasing the latching member toward the open front end so that the latching member protrudes outside through the open front end of the casing, a locking mechanism capable of locking the latching member at a locking position within the casing against the biasing force of the biasing means and of unlocking the latching member when the latching member is pushed from the locking position against the biasing force of the biasing means to an unlocking position within the casing, and a safety mechanism capable of preventing the disengagement of the locking mechanism by inertia. The locking mechanism comprises a locking lever that engages a heart-shaped cam groove formed in the latching member, and the safety mechanism comprises a movable member pivotally supporting the locking lever, supported for sliding movement within the casing and capable of moving in the direction of movement of the latching member by inertia, and spring means for biasing the movable member toward the latching member.

    • A molding for a front glass mounted continuously, from right and left front pillar portions to a roof portion, to a gap between a peripheral portion of a front glass of a vehicle and a window frame of a body of the vehicle. The molding has a groove lip which is formed of a different material than a material of a leg portion, a head portion, a glass lip and a panel lip, and which extends over a predetermined length from a lower portion to an upper portion of the front pillar portion. The extended length of the groove lip becomes gradually shorter and disappears over a corner portion of the upper portion of the front pillar portion and the roof portion. The leg portion, the head portion, the glass lip, the panel lip and the groove lip are integrally extrusion-molded. The entire sectional configuration does not deform at a portion whose cross-section is changed, and high adhesion of the molding to the front glass can be maintained.
